In a dream, Qu You sees Zhou Tan, the infamous historical minister with a notorious reputation, dr*pe a coat over her shoulders on a cold winter night.
When she wakes up, she finds herself reincarnated as Zhou Tan’s bride-to-be in an arranged marriage meant to bring him good fortune.
Qu You has heard countless rumors about Zhou Tan: how he betrayed his sect as a youth, later rose to power with ruthless tactics, stubbornly pushed through a solitary reform that ended in failure, and died at the age of 31 in his hometown, leaving behind only a tarnished legacy.
But when she gazes upon the lonely minister again through a garden full of apricot blossoms, she suddenly feels that the history books are teetering on shaky ground.
—Amidst the stormy winds, she glimpses the upright and noble spirit hidden beneath his exterior.
